The primary Personal computer networks had been dedicated Exclusive-goal systems like SABRE (an airline reservation program) and AUTODIN I (a defense command-and-Command program), equally designed and carried out while in the late fifties and early 1960s. From the early 1960s Personal computer suppliers had started to use semiconductor technology in professional products, and equally common batch-processing and time-sharing systems had been set up in lots of substantial, technologically State-of-the-art corporations. Time-sharing systems permitted a pc’s sources for being shared in speedy succession with numerous people, biking with the queue of people so quickly that the computer appeared devoted to Each and every user’s responsibilities Regardless of the existence of many others accessing the program “at the same time.” This led on the Idea of sharing Personal computer sources (known as host pcs or just hosts) above a complete community. Host-to-host interactions had been envisioned, together with entry to specialised sources (like supercomputers and mass storage systems) and interactive access by remote people on the computational powers of time-sharing systems Situated somewhere else. These Tips had been initial realized in ARPANET, which recognized the 1st host-to-host community relationship on October 29, 1969. It absolutely was made with the Advanced Investigate Tasks Company (ARPA) from the U.S. Office of Protection. ARPANET was among the list of initial typical-goal Personal computer networks. It connected time-sharing pcs at federal government-supported analysis websites, principally universities in The usa, and it quickly grew to become a important piece of infrastructure for the computer science analysis Group in The usa. Equipment and purposes—like the straightforward mail transfer protocol (SMTP, generally generally known as e-mail), for sending shorter messages, and the file transfer protocol (FTP), for for a longer time transmissions—quickly emerged. To be able to realize Charge-effective interactive communications between pcs, which typically connect To put it briefly bursts of data, ARPANET employed The brand new technology of packet switching. Packet switching can take substantial messages (or chunks of Personal computer information) and breaks them into smaller sized, workable pieces (referred to as packets) that will vacation independently above any accessible circuit on the goal spot, in which the pieces are reassembled. As a result, compared with common voice communications, packet switching will not require a one dedicated circuit between Each and every pair of people. Commercial packet networks had been released while in the nineteen seventies, but these had been designed principally to provide effective entry to remote pcs by dedicated terminals. Briefly, they replaced extensive-distance modem connections by a lot less-costly “virtual” circuits above packet networks. In The usa, Telenet and Tymnet had been two these packet networks. Neither supported host-to-host communications; while in the nineteen seventies this was still the province from the analysis networks, and it could continue being so for quite some time. DARPA (Protection Advanced Investigate Tasks Company; formerly ARPA) supported initiatives for floor-based mostly and satellite-based mostly packet networks. The ground-based mostly packet radio program furnished cell entry to computing sources, when the packet satellite community connected The usa with various European international locations and enabled connections with extensively dispersed and remote areas. With the introduction of packet radio, connecting a cell terminal to a pc community grew to become possible. Nevertheless, time-sharing systems had been then still way too substantial, unwieldy, and expensive for being cell or even to exist outside a local climate-controlled computing environment. A solid inspiration Therefore existed to attach the packet radio community to ARPANET in order to permit cell people with straightforward terminals to access time-sharing systems for which they’d authorization. Equally, the packet satellite community was utilized by DARPA to backlink The usa with satellite terminals serving the United Kingdom, Norway, Germany, and Italy. These terminals, nonetheless, had to be connected to other networks in European international locations in order to reach the end people. As a result arose the necessity to link the packet satellite Web, in addition to the packet radio Web, with other networks. Foundation of the net The world wide web resulted from the hassle to attach various analysis networks in The usa and Europe. First, DARPA recognized a software to analyze the interconnection of “heterogeneous networks.” This software, known as Internetting, was determined by the newly released concept of open up architecture networking, by which networks with described common interfaces could be interconnected by “gateways.” A working demonstration from the concept was prepared. To ensure that the concept to work, a fresh protocol had to be designed and developed; indeed, a program architecture was also essential. In 1974 Vinton Cerf, then at Stanford College in California, and this creator, then at DARPA, collaborated with a paper that initial described such a protocol and program architecture—particularly, the transmission Command protocol (TCP), which enabled different types of machines on networks all over the planet to route and assemble information packets. TCP, which at first included the net protocol (IP), a world addressing mechanism that permitted routers to receive information packets to their supreme spot, shaped the TCP/IP common, which was adopted with the U.S. Office of Protection in 1980. From the early 1980s the “open up architecture” from the TCP/IP tactic was adopted and endorsed by many other scientists and finally by technologists and businessmen around the world. From the 1980s other U.S. governmental bodies had been greatly associated with networking, such as the National Science Foundation (NSF), the Office of Power, and the National Aeronautics and Place Administration (NASA). Though DARPA had played a seminal position in creating a small-scale Edition of the net among its scientists, NSF labored with DARPA to increase entry to the whole scientific and tutorial Group and to generate TCP/IP the common in all federally supported analysis networks. In 1985–86 NSF funded the 1st five supercomputing centres—at Princeton College, the College of Pittsburgh, the College of California, San Diego, the College of Illinois, and Cornell College. In the 1980s NSF also funded the development and Procedure from the NSFNET, a countrywide “backbone” community to attach these centres. From the late 1980s the community was working at a lot of bits per next. NSF also funded various nonprofit neighborhood and regional networks to attach other people on the NSFNET. A few professional networks also commenced while in the late 1980s; these had been quickly joined by others, and the Commercial Net Trade (CIX) was shaped to allow transit targeted traffic between professional networks that in any other case wouldn’t are already permitted on the NSFNET backbone. In 1995, immediately after in depth evaluate of the specific situation, NSF made a decision that guidance from the NSFNET infrastructure was no more essential, considering that several professional suppliers had been now keen and in the position to meet the needs from the analysis Group, and its guidance was withdrawn. Meanwhile, NSF had fostered a aggressive assortment of commercial Net backbones connected to each other as a result of so-known as community access points (NAPs).
